Heather’s friend Rebecca Paull Marshall designed the invitation and two-sided reply card. We printed them in a single color (handmixed brown) onto 110-lb cotton paper (pearl white).

Since the invitation image was fairly large (in terms of our 8×12 press), it took a bit of work with the makeready to ensure an even impression for both the woodgrain and text. At the recommendation of our friend Keith (whose Chandler & Price Craftsman paper cutter we’re using), I’ve recently started using vellum for the makeready and have been really happy with the results.
